Princeton UniversityEach of us harbor biological timers in our bodies known as the circadian clock. These clocks drive physiological processes and behaviors in coordination with the day-night cycle. Recent work has provided evidence that the circadian clock regulates immune functions in coordination with the day-night cycle. However, the underlying mechanisms by which the circadian clock drives rhythms in immunity are ill-defined. The Brooks lab seeks to mechanistically determine circadian clock regulation of innate immune functions at the intestinal epithelial barrier.
